Formally Haydock held a reputation of being a serious jumping test over fences, but things changed a few years back there and they now have portable fences which are a bit more forgiving and are positioned on their outer flat track. It’s basically a good, galloping track but with quite tight bends. As the season goes on through the winter the ground can undergo a massive change. It’s often very testing in winter for the Betfair Chase and conversely for the Swinton Hurdle in the spring the ground becomes quick and the track is suddenly a lot sharper, therefore suiting a variety of run styles
